Inorganic Pigment Manufacturers Europe: Why They Dominate Industrial Applications
Inorganic pigments continue to dominate European industrial usage due to their:
- High thermal stability
- Excellent lightfastness
- Chemical resistance
- Long service life
European inorganic pigment manufacturers specialize in products such as:
- Ultramarine Blue pigments
- Iron oxide pigments
- Chromium oxide greens
- Titanium dioxide extenders
- Mixed metal oxide pigments

Role of Industrial Pigment Distributors Europe Trusts
Not all buyers source directly from manufacturers. In fact, many OEMs and medium-scale processors rely on industrial pigment distributors Europe to manage logistics, compliance documentation, and local inventory.
What Industrial Pigment Distributors Offer
- Warehousing and just-in-time delivery
- Local technical assistance
- Regulatory documentation support
- Smaller MOQ options compared to manufacturers
For international suppliers and exporters, partnering with established industrial pigment distributors Europe is often the fastest route to market penetration and customer trust.

What Defines the Best Pigment Manufacturers in Europe?
For global buyers, identifying the best pigment manufacturers in Europe requires evaluating more than just product range.
Key Evaluation Criteria
1. Regulatory Compliance
The best pigment manufacturers in Europe are fully compliant with:
- REACH regulations
- ISO 9001 / ISO 14001 standards
- Industry-specific norms for coatings and plastics
2. Technical Documentation
Leading manufacturers provide:
- Detailed Technical Data Sheets (TDS)
- Safety Data Sheets (SDS)
- Application guidance
3. Industry Focus
Top suppliers specialize rather than generalize, serving defined industries such as:
- Plastics and masterbatch
- Industrial coatings
- Printing inks
4. Supply Chain Reliability
Consistency in:
- Batch-to-batch color
- Particle size distribution
- Long-term supply contracts
These factors separate average suppliers from the best pigment manufacturers in Europe.
